Hello, I have a 8 week old son and from 2nd week I've been pumping once a day to get a good frozen supply incase of emergencies. I can't pump more than once as my DS refuses a dummy so uses me for comfort and food but I don't mind. My freezer needs defrosting as DH left freezer door partly open for I think an hour so it's now all frozen inside and am struggling to pull draws out. I'm wondering how to save my frozen milk if u have any advice. Is there a product or anything anyone has used to stop defrosting. Don't wanna lose my back up supply x

minipie · 28/06/2022 09:41

Oh no OP!

Do you have a cool bag and any frozen cool blocks - that should keep the milk frozen for a while especially if you put it in a cool room. Might be long enough to allow you to sort the freezer?

Alternatively any neighbours you could ask to store the milk just while you sort the freezer?

dementedpixie · 28/06/2022 09:42

Cool bag with ice blocks or bags of ice cubes to keep them cool.

dementedpixie · 28/06/2022 09:55

I'm sure it's not advised but I used to speed things up using a hairdryer. Just make sure no water can drip in it.

Or I've heard putting a bowl of boiling water in the freezer can help melt the ice too

Noix · 28/06/2022 12:21

You can order a styrofoam box and dry ice online which will keep it frozen for days if need be.
